摘要
指纹图像的质量直接影响着指纹识别系统的可靠性和正确性,如何有效的评估指纹图像的质量和排除低质量的指纹图像是一个比较难的问题。在灰度图像处理的研究基础上,给出了一套基于图像灰度和指纹纹理的指纹图像质量预评价方法。该方法充分考虑指纹识别系统的特点,设立关键参数,并把分步排除与综合评价相结合。该方法速度快、占用内存小,能很好的评估指纹图像的质量,提高系统的可靠性。
Fingerprint recognition technology is widely applied as a type of biologic recognition technology nowdays. The quality of the fingerprint image has a direct influence on the reliability and correctness of the fingerprint identification system. The question is how to evaluate the quality of the fingerprint image effectively and how to obviate the low quality of the fingerprint image. Based on the analysis and study of grey image, a method is put forward, which is based on the gray level and texture of the image, to pre-evaluate the image quality. Taking into account characteristic of fingerprint recognition system enough, setting up key parameter, combining step exclusion and synthetic evaluation, this method has the advantage of smaller memory and fast calculating speed, thus the reliability of fingerprint recognition system effectively is improved.
